MCP Gateway
MCPゲートウェイとは?
MCPゲートウェイは、Model Context Protocol (MCP)サーバーを管理するために特別に設計された強力なDockerコマンドラインプラグインです。これは、Dockerコンテナ内でさまざまなMCPサーバーを簡単にデプロイ、構成、管理するためのスマートなマネージャーのような存在で、AIアシスタント(ClaudeやCursorなど)が外部のツールやサービスに安全にアクセスして使用できるようにします。MCPゲートウェイの使い方は?
インストール後、簡単なDockerコマンドを使用してMCPサーバーを管理できます。利用可能なサーバーの検索、コンテナへのデプロイ、AIクライアントへの接続、セキュリティ資格情報の管理など。全体的なプロセスは、通常のDockerコンテナの管理と同じくらい簡単で直感的です。適用シナリオ
AIアシスタント環境で外部ツールやサービスを統合する必要のある開発者、AIエンジニア、データサイエンティストなどのユーザーに適しています。Claudeにデータベースクエリ機能を追加したい場合でも、CursorがAPIサービスにアクセスできるようにしたい場合でも、MCPゲートウェイが簡単に実現できます。主要機能
サーバーカタログ管理
利用可能なMCPサーバーを検索、閲覧、管理し、OCIレジストリからサーバーイメージを取得することができ、必要なツールやサービスを簡単に見つけることができます。
Dockerコンテナ化デプロイ
MCPサーバーをDockerコンテナとして実行し、環境の分離、リソースの制御、管理の容易さを確保し、自動構成と起動をサポートします。
複数クライアントサポート
Claude Desktop、Cursor、VS Code、Zedなどの主要なAIクライアントをサポートし、クライアントの接続を自動的に構成し、手動で構成ファイルを変更する必要はありません。
セキュリティ資格情報管理
APIキー、アクセストークンなどの機密情報を安全に保存および管理し、OAuth認証フローをサポートし、データのセキュリティを保護します。
アクセスポリシー制御
細かいアクセス制御ポリシーを定義し、どのツールがどのクライアントによってアクセスできるかを制限し、安全で管理可能な使用環境を確保します。
構成のバックアップと復元
MCPサーバーのすべての構成(カタログ、接続設定、セキュリティ資格情報など)をバックアップおよび復元し、移行や災害復旧を容易にします。
利点
即時使用可能:インストール後すぐに使用でき、複雑な構成プロセスは必要ありません
コンテナ化分離:各MCPサーバーは独立したDockerコンテナで実行され、相互に干渉しません
統一管理:統一されたDockerコマンドですべてのMCPサーバーを管理でき、学習コストが低い
安全で信頼性が高い:組み込みのセキュリティメカニズムで機密情報を保護し、アクセス制御ポリシーをサポートする
豊富なエコシステム:複数のAIクライアントとMCPサーバーをサポートし、拡張性が高い
制限
Dockerに依存:Docker環境をインストールして実行する必要があります
学習曲線:基本的なDockerとMCPの概念を理解する必要があります
リソース占有:各MCPサーバーには独立したコンテナリソースが必要です
ネットワーク要件:一部のサーバーは外部ネットワークリソースにアクセスする必要がある場合があります
使い方
MCPゲートウェイのインストール
まず、ソースコードからプラグインをビルドし、Docker CLIプラグインディレクトリにインストールします。Go言語環境とDockerがインストールされていることを確認してください。
利用可能なサーバーの閲覧
利用可能なMCPサーバーのカタログを表示し、どのツールやサービスが利用できるかを確認します。
MCPサーバーのデプロイ
必要なMCPサーバーを選択し、Dockerコンテナとしてデプロイします。システムが自動的に構成と起動を処理します。
AIクライアントへの接続
デプロイしたMCPサーバーをClaude DesktopやCursorなどのAIクライアントに接続します。
セキュリティ資格情報の構成
認証が必要なMCPサーバーにAPIキーまたはその他のセキュリティ資格情報を設定します。
使用例
Claudeにデータベースクエリ機能を追加する
SQLクエリをサポートするMCPサーバーをデプロイし、Claudeが直接データベースをクエリしてデータを取得できるようにします。
Cursorに天気APIを統合する
天気クエリ用のMCPサーバーをデプロイし、Cursorがコードを記述する際にリアルタイムの天気情報を取得できるようにします。
VS Codeにコード分析ツールを追加する
コード品質チェック用のMCPサーバーをデプロイし、VS Codeでコード品質をリアルタイムに分析し、改善提案を提供します。
よくある質問
MCPゲートウェイと通常のDockerの違いは何ですか?
MCPプロトコルを理解する必要がありますか?
MCPゲートウェイは安全ですか?
どのAIクライアントをサポートしていますか?
カスタムのMCPサーバーを追加するにはどうすればいいですか?
MCPサーバーはAIアシスタントのパフォーマンスに影響しますか?
関連リソース
GitHubリポジトリ
MCPゲートウェイのソースコードと最新バージョン
Model Context Protocol公式サイト
MCPプロトコルの公式ドキュメントと仕様
Dockerドキュメント
Dockerの公式使用ドキュメント
MCPサーバーの例
公式が提供するMCPサーバーの例
Claude Desktop構成ガイド
Claude Desktopの構成と使用ガイド

Edgeone Pages MCP Server
EdgeOne Pages MCPは、MCPプロトコルを通じてHTMLコンテンツをEdgeOne Pagesに迅速にデプロイし、公開URLを取得するサービスです。
TypeScript
24.8K
4.8ポイント

Gmail MCP Server
Claude Desktop用に設計されたGmail自動認証MCPサーバーで、自然言語でのやり取りによるGmailの管理をサポートし、メール送信、ラベル管理、一括操作などの完全な機能を備えています。
TypeScript
19.5K
4.5ポイント

Context7
Context7 MCPは、AIプログラミングアシスタントにリアルタイムのバージョン固有のドキュメントとコード例を提供するサービスで、Model Context Protocolを通じてプロンプトに直接統合され、LLMが古い情報を使用する問題を解決します。
TypeScript
77.2K
4.7ポイント

Baidu Map
認証済み
百度マップMCPサーバーは国内初のMCPプロトコルに対応した地図サービスで、地理コーディング、ルート計画など10個の標準化されたAPIインターフェースを提供し、PythonとTypescriptでの迅速な接続をサポートし、エージェントに地図関連の機能を実現させます。
Python
35.8K
4.5ポイント

Gitlab MCP Server
認証済み
GitLab MCPサーバーは、Model Context Protocolに基づくプロジェクトで、GitLabアカウントとのやり取りに必要な包括的なツールセットを提供します。コードレビュー、マージリクエスト管理、CI/CD設定などの機能が含まれます。
TypeScript
22.0K
4.3ポイント

Unity
認証済み
UnityMCPはUnityエディターのプラグインで、モデルコンテキストプロトコル (MCP) を実装し、UnityとAIアシスタントのシームレスな統合を提供します。リアルタイムの状態監視、リモートコマンドの実行、ログ機能が含まれます。
C#
27.8K
5ポイント

Magic MCP
Magic Component Platform (MCP) はAI駆動のUIコンポーネント生成ツールで、自然言語での記述を通じて、開発者が迅速に現代的なUIコンポーネントを作成するのを支援し、複数のIDEとの統合をサポートします。
JavaScript
19.4K
5ポイント

Sequential Thinking MCP Server
MCPプロトコルに基づく構造化思考サーバーで、思考段階を定義することで複雑な問題を分解し要約を生成するのに役立ちます。
Python
30.7K
4.5ポイント



